Mayor Nick Molnar is excited to kick off the return of Macedonia’s Business of the Month program in 2026 by recognizing Wholly Frijoles Mexican Street Food as the January Business of the Month. A proud Nordonia Hills Chamber of Commerce member, Wholly Frijoles is a local success story that continues to strengthen our business community.


What started as a single food truck has grown into three brick-and-mortar locations, including one right here in Macedonia at 9828 Valley View Road.

Mayor Molnar recently spoke with Wholly Frijoles owner Juan Gonzalez to talk about the restaurant’s journey and what makes it special. From day one, the focus has been on authentic, fresh Mexican street food, with everything made from scratch in-house. The menu features customer favorites like burritos, quesadillas, and rich, flavorful birria, along with seasonal highlights such as Mexican street corn made with locally sourced ingredients. (And yes — the Mayor highly recommends the chicken quesadilla paired with a classic Mexican Coke.)


Tucked in the Center Pointe Plaza in Macedonia, Wholly Frijoles offers fast-casual dining with both indoor seating and a summer patio. Guests can also enjoy margaritas made with quality tequila, weekly Taco Tuesday specials with a dollar off tacos, and convenient online ordering directly on their website for pickup or delivery.

Wholly Frijoles is open Tuesday through Saturday from 11 a.m. to 9 p.m., and closed on Sundays and Mondays.
